Overview

Hamar is Lagadagr’s coastal shipwright village, specializing in ship construction and repair. The village features numerous docks with vessels in various stages of construction, from small merchant ships to grand Nordic longships. Under the leadership of Jarl Hrothgar - a master shipwright who detests “barbaric traditions” - Hamar maintains a working-class atmosphere focused on craftsmanship over politics.

The village’s greatest creation is The Laughing Dawn, an orca-themed vessel commissioned for the party featuring a living tree on deck, koi ponds, and a treehouse lookout. Hamar workers cater to maritime trades, with granaries and cattle farms supporting the population alongside shipbuilding income.
